Job description
Overview

Job Title: HVAC Service Engineer
Location: London & Surrounding Areas (Travel Paid Door to Door)
Salary: £40,000 - £50,000 OTE
Hours: Full-time, minimum 40 hours/week

The Role

Join a well-established air conditioning contractor with over 30 years in the industry. As a Service Engineer, you'll carry out maintenance and attend breakdowns on a range of HVAC systems, primarily in the hospitality sector across the London area.

What’s on Offer
  • OTE £40,000 - £50,000
  • Paid travel (door to door)
  • Generous overtime and standby rates (3/4-week call-out rota)
  • Company van (with AC and hands-free kit)
  • iPhone, tools, and uniform provided
  • 28 days holiday (including bank holidays)
Key Duties
  • Regular maintenance and servicing of HVAC systems
  • Work on chilled water, heat pump A/C systems, extraction and filtration plant
  • Fault finding and repair of HVAC control systems
  • Emergency call-outs as part of a rotational standby schedule
Requirements
  • Experience with air handling units, kitchen extract systems, and air conditioning
  • F-Gas certification (essential)
  • CSCS card (required)
  • Strong fault-finding skills and understanding of HVAC control panels
  • Manufacturer training (e.g. Daikin) preferred
  • Experience in the restaurant/hospitality sector is a bonus
